Shell Eco Marathon

Shell Eco-marathon is a competition in the Americas, Europe, and Asia for high school and college students to develop efficient vehicles. 

Kettering University's team, Electric Bulldog, is a group of passionate, enthusiastic A-Section and B-Section undergraduate and graduate students who are members of the Greener Engineering Organization. Our vehicle will be in the Battery-electric Prototype category, attempting to build the most efficient car possible using the least amount of battery power to travel maximum distance.

Competition Categories

Prototypes

  • Gasoline
  • Diesel
  • Alternative Fuel  
  • CNG
  • Battery-electric
  • Hydrogen Fuel Cell

Urban Concept

  • Gasoline
  • Diesel
  • Alternative Fuel
  • CNG
  • Battery-electric
  • Hydrogen Fuel & Cell

Teams are tested over several days on a track and the energy efficiency of each vehicle is calculated. The team to drive the furthest on the equivalent of one liter of fuel in each category wins.
